Insurance can be prohibitively expensive, but you may find discounts to cut the cost considerably. Some trigger automatically at the time of purchase, but less common discounts must be specially asked for before you get the savings.

  • Seat Belts Save – Requiring all passengers to buckle their seat belts could save 15% off the personal injury premium cost.
  • Military Rewards – Being deployed with a military unit may qualify for rate reductions.
  • Drive Safe and Save – Drivers who avoid accidents may receive a discount up to 45% less on Caprice coverage than drivers with accidents.
  • Accident Free – Drivers with accident-free driving histories can save substantially compared to frequent claim filers.
  • Homeowners Discount – Being a homeowner can help you save on car insurance because maintaining a house is proof that your finances are in order.

It’s important to note that most of the big mark downs will not be given to your bottom line cost. Most only cut the price of certain insurance coverages like collision or personal injury protection. So even though it sounds like you could get a free car insurance policy, it just doesn’t work that way. Any amount of discount will help reduce the amount you have to pay.

Educate yourself about car insurance coverages

Knowing the specifics of your car insurance policy helps when choosing the best coverages for your vehicles. Car insurance terms can be difficult to understand and reading a policy is terribly boring. Listed below are typical coverages found on the average car insurance policy.

Medical expense insurance

Personal Injury Protection (PIP) and medical payments coverage provide coverage for short-term medical expenses like doctor visits, nursing services, X-ray expenses, EMT expenses and funeral costs. They can be used to fill the gap from your health insurance policy or if you are not covered by health insurance. They cover not only the driver but also the vehicle occupants and also covers being hit by a car walking across the street. PIP is not available in all states and may carry a deductible

Liability

This protects you from damage or injury you incur to other’s property or people in an accident. It consists of three limits, bodily injury for each person injured, bodily injury for the entire accident and a property damage limit. You might see liability limits of 25/50/25 which stand for a $25,000 limit per person for injuries, $50,000 for the entire accident, and a total limit of $25,000 for damage to vehicles and property. Another option is one limit called combined single limit (CSL) that pays claims from the same limit without having the split limit caps.

Liability insurance covers claims like medical expenses, emergency aid and structural damage. How much coverage you buy is a personal decision, but buy higher limits if possible.

Comprehensive (Other than Collision)

Comprehensive insurance pays for damage that is not covered by collision coverage. You need to pay your deductible first then your comprehensive coverage will pay.

Comprehensive insurance covers things such as fire damage, damage from getting keyed, hail damage and damage from flooding. The highest amount you can receive from a comprehensive claim is the market value of your vehicle, so if your deductible is as high as the vehicle’s value consider removing comprehensive coverage.

Protection from uninsured/underinsured drivers

This gives you protection from other drivers when they either have no liability insurance or not enough. Covered losses include hospital bills for your injuries and also any damage incurred to your Chevy Caprice.

Because many people only purchase the least amount of liability that is required, it only takes a small accident to exceed their coverage. This is the reason having UM/UIM coverage is important protection for you and your family. Frequently these coverages do not exceed the liability coverage limits.

Collision coverage

Collision insurance pays to fix your vehicle from damage resulting from a collision with a stationary object or other vehicle. You have to pay a deductible and the rest of the damage will be paid by collision coverage.

Collision insurance covers things such as crashing into a building, sustaining damage from a pot hole and backing into a parked car. This coverage can be expensive, so consider dropping it from lower value vehicles. You can also raise the deductible to bring the cost down.
